名词 n.
  1. A dynamic sign indicating that a portion of music should be played pianissimo.
  2. A portion of music that is played very softly.
    — If the Randall Thompson Alleluia lacked the otherworldly awe and mystery the composer intended, the BGMC offered a fair accounting of the work with some wonderfully hushed pianissimos and clearly delineated contrasts in mood.
副词 adv.
  1. Indicating that the piece is to be played very softly.
